在使用GitHub进行项目管理时,用户可能会遇到上传后掉线的问题。本文将详细探讨这一问题的原因、解决方案以及常见问答,帮助开发者更好地利用GitHub进行协作与开发。
什么是GitHub上传后掉线?
GitHub上传后掉线是指在用户将代码或项目上传至GitHub后,可能会出现连接中断或无法访问的问题。这种情况可能导致代码未能成功上传,影响项目的持续开发。
掉线的表现
- 无法访问GitHub网页或API。
- 上传进度卡住或中断。
- 提交时显示错误信息。
- 项目无法正常显示在GitHub上。
GitHub上传后掉线的原因
导致GitHub上传后掉线的原因有很多,主要可以分为以下几类:
1. 网络问题
网络连接的不稳定是导致掉线的最常见原因之一,包括:
- Wi-Fi信号弱
- 网络延迟或丢包
- 防火墙或代理设置影响连接
2. GitHub服务器问题
偶尔GitHub服务器本身可能会出现问题,包括:
- 服务器维护或升级
- 服务器故障
3. 本地环境问题
用户本地的开发环境也可能导致上传问题,例如:
- Git版本过旧
- 配置文件错误
- 依赖项缺失
如何解决GitHub上传后掉线的问题
针对上述原因,用户可以采取以下解决方案:
1. 检查网络连接
- 确保网络信号强且稳定。
- 尝试重启路由器或使用有线网络。
- 检查防火墙或代理设置,确保GitHub不被阻止。
2. 查看GitHub服务器状态
- 访问 GitHub状态页面 查看服务器是否正常运行。
- 如果服务器正在维护,耐心等待恢复。
3. 更新本地Git
-
确保安装了最新版本的Git。
-
使用以下命令更新Git: bash git –version # 查看当前版本
-
若版本过旧,请前往Git官方网站下载并安装最新版本。
4. 配置检查
- 确认本地的
.git/config
文件设置是否正确。 - 检查SSH密钥是否正确配置。
- 如果使用HTTPS,确保使用的是正确的用户名和密码。
常见问题解答(FAQ)
1. GitHub上传后掉线怎么办?
如果你遇到上传后掉线的问题,首先检查网络连接是否正常。如果网络良好,可以查看GitHub的状态,若一切正常,请更新本地的Git版本及配置文件。
2. 上传到GitHub时遇到403错误,这是什么原因?
403错误通常表示权限不足,可能是因为使用了错误的凭据。检查你的GitHub账户设置,确保使用了正确的访问令牌或SSH密钥。
3. 如何避免GitHub上传掉线?
为了避免上传掉线,建议使用稳定的网络连接,并定期更新Git工具。此外,可以考虑将代码分块上传,避免一次性上传过大的文件。
4. GitHub上传掉线后如何恢复?
如果上传掉线,可以尝试重新提交代码。如果发现本地仓库与GitHub不一致,可以使用git status
命令查看当前状态,并通过git push
命令重新上传。
总结
GitHub上传后掉线的问题虽然常见,但通过了解其原因和解决方案,用户可以有效减少此类问题的发生。定期检查网络环境和Git工具的配置,将有助于提升开发效率。
希望本文能够帮助你更好地使用GitHub进行项目管理。